Whispers of the Imperial Court: The False Prefect's Ruse
In the heart of the ancient dynasty, where the sun rose and set over the sprawling palace complex, there lived a young official named Gao Zichun. Known for his sharp mind and unwavering loyalty, Gao had earned the trust of the Emperor, who had tasked him with a seemingly simple yet critical mission: to oversee the affairs of the False Prefect, a figure who, despite his title, was little more than a shadow in the court.
The False Prefect, a man of ambiguous origins, had risen to power by weaving a web of intrigue and deceit. His influence was pervasive, yet he remained unseen, his presence known only through whispered tales of his cunning and malevolence. The Emperor, though suspicious, had found himself unable to uncover the truth behind the False Prefect's enigmatic facade.
Gao Zichun, however, was not one to be deterred by the shadows. His eyes were sharp, his mind agile, and his resolve unyielding. He knew that the False Prefect's ruse was not just a threat to the Emperor's reign but to the very stability of the dynasty itself.
The story begins with Gao being summoned to the Emperor's private quarters. The air was thick with tension, the scent of incense mingling with the fear that clung to the walls. The Emperor, a man of stern features and piercing eyes, addressed Gao with a gravity that was rare even for him.
"Zichun," the Emperor began, his voice low and grave, "I have tasked you with a most perilous endeavor. The False Prefect's ruse is a cancer at the heart of my court. You must uncover the truth and bring him to justice."
Gao bowed, his expression serene. "I shall not fail you, Your Majesty."
From that moment on, Gao's life was a series of calculated moves. He mingled with the courtiers, his presence unremarkable, yet his ears were attuned to the smallest of whispers. He observed the False Prefect's actions, noting the subtle cues that suggested a man who was far more than he appeared.
As the days passed, Gao began to piece together a puzzle that was both intricate and terrifying. The False Prefect, it seemed, had managed to manipulate the highest ranks of the court, his influence extending far beyond what anyone had imagined. Gao's investigation led him to a series of encounters that tested his resolve and his wits.
One evening, as the moon hung low in the sky, Gao found himself in the company of a mysterious woman, her face obscured by a veil. She spoke of the False Prefect's true nature, her voice trembling with fear and desperation. "He is not who he claims to be," she whispered. "He is a traitor, a man who seeks to undermine the Emperor and seize the throne."
Gao listened, his mind racing. The woman's words were a bombshell, but they also provided the missing piece of the puzzle. He knew that the False Prefect's ruse was more than a political game; it was a threat to the very fabric of the dynasty.
With the woman's information in hand, Gao set a trap. He arranged a meeting with the False Prefect under the guise of a celebration, a feast designed to lure him into a vulnerable position. The night of the feast was a whirlwind of activity, the hall filled with courtiers and officials, all of them aware of the impending danger but none more so than Gao.
As the False Prefect arrived, his confidence was palpable. He moved through the crowd with ease, his eyes never leaving Gao. The atmosphere was tense, the air thick with anticipation. Then, without warning, Gao's plan unfolded.
In a swift and precise movement, Gao exposed the False Prefect's true identity. The revelation was a shock to all, including the False Prefect himself, who had believed he had gone undetected. The Emperor, who had been watching from a nearby room, emerged to confront the traitor.
"You thought you could fool me," the Emperor said, his voice cold and steady. "But you were wrong. You are no longer the False Prefect. You are a traitor, and you will pay for your crimes."
The False Prefect, now stripped of his title and his power, was led away in chains. The court erupted in cheers, the relief and joy of the revelation spreading like wildfire. Gao Zichun, the young official who had been tasked with uncovering the truth, was hailed as a hero.
The False Prefect's ruse had been a cunning plot, but it had met its match in Gao Zichun's unwavering determination. His victory had not only saved the dynasty from a dangerous threat but also restored faith in the Emperor's rule.
In the aftermath of the False Prefect's downfall, Gao Zichun continued to serve the Emperor with distinction. He had learned a valuable lesson from the shadows of the dynasty: that truth, even in the darkest of times, would always find a way to shine through.
As the years passed, the story of Gao Zichun and the False Prefect's ruse became a legend, whispered among the courtiers and common folk alike. It was a tale of courage, cunning, and the enduring fight against the shadows that seek to undermine the light of justice.
